what size tires for 18" fx2 rims

I have a chance to buy a new set of 18" fx2 rims to put on my 04 fx4 for $400. I am not sure what size tire i should put on these can anyone recommend a size? I dont have an leveling kit on my truck now but was looking into putting on a set of the bilstein 5100's but would love suggestions on tires for before the shocks and after. Also does anyone have the measurements of the backspacing on these rims?

The OEM wheels are 18x7.5 inches. If you level the truck a 285/65-18 (33x11.50), 305/60-18 (33x12.50) or 305/65-18 (34x12.50) will look great.

Thanks for the info Wandell. I also found some tires tires for these rims for the same price. a set of terra grapplers with less than 2000 miles on the for $400 as well. They are 325/65/18 will these fit on there as well?

Those are basically a 35x13.00 tire. One member here is running that size, but they are too wide for the oem 7.5 inch wide wheels. You will have some rubbing on the control arms at full steering lock. Also, running too wide of a tire on a narrow wheel can cause the center portion of the tread to wear slightly faster than normal. However, for $400 it may be worth it.
